Billie Eilish Birth Chart Overview

  • Birth Date: December 18, 2001
  • Birth Time: 11:30 am (Astro-Databank AA source)
  • Birth Place: Los Angeles, California, USA

Billie Eilish’s Sun Sign Is Visionary Sagittarius

Billie was born with the Sun in Sagittarius. The Sun represents the core identity and the ego. Sagittarius is a Fire sign known for honesty and freedom.

People with this placement value truth above all else. They hate fake behavior. You see this in how Billie interacts with the media. She speaks her mind. She does not follow a script. Sagittarius energy is bold and expansive. It seeks to explore the world and break boundaries.

Her Sun resides in the 10th House. This is the House of Career and Public Image. A Sun in the 10th House indicates a person born to shine in the public eye. Fame is almost inevitable with this placement. She projects her true self to the world without fear. Her career is not just a job; it is an extension of her identity.

Billie Eilish Moon Sign: Aquarius' Detached Genius

While her Sun shines bright, her emotional world is governed by the Moon in Aquarius. This is a fascinating and somewhat difficult placement. The Moon represents our feelings, and Aquarius is an air sign known for being detached, intellectual, and unique.

People with an Aquarius Moon often feel like outsiders, as if they are observing humanity from a distance. This explains the themes of isolation, alienation, and "being the bad guy" in her music. She processes emotions not by drowning in them, but by analyzing them.

This placement also gifts her with a humanitarian spirit and a connection to the collective. She intuitively understands what society is feeling, specifically the anxieties of Gen Z. The Aquarius Moon allows her to take personal pain and turn it into art that feels universal. It also fuels her rebellious fashion sense; an Aquarius Moon refuses to dress or act like anyone else.

Billie Eilish Rising Sign: Pisces' Dreamy "Ocean Eyes"

Billie Eilish Ocean Eyes

If her Sun is her drive and her Moon is her heart, her Rising Sign (Ascendant) is the mask she wears. For Billie, that mask is pure Pisces.

This is perhaps the most literal manifestation in her chart. Her breakout hit, "Ocean Eyes," is practically an anthem for the Pisces Ascendant. Pisces Risings have a soft, ethereal appearance, often with large, watery eyes that seem to look into your soul. They come across as empathetic, sensitive, and slightly mysterious.

The Pisces Rising places Jupiter (the traditional ruler of Pisces) and Neptune (the modern ruler) in significant positions. It gives her that "chameleon" quality. One day she is blonde and Marilyn Monroe-esque; the next she is in neon green roots and baggy shorts. Pisces is a fluid water sign, allowing her to shape-shift effortlessly. It also makes her incredibly porous to the energy around her, which is why she often needs to retreat from the public eye to recharge.

Key Planetary Placements That Define Her Talent

Beyond the Big Three, specific planets in Billie’s chart color her unique artistic voice.

Mars in Pisces: The Soft Power

Billie has Mars in Pisces in the 12th House. Mars is the planet of action, aggression, and drive. In Pisces, Mars is not aggressive in a traditional, fiery way. It is passive, creative, and spiritual.

Placed in the 12th House (the house of the subconscious and hidden things), this suggests that her drive comes from a deep, internal place. She doesn't fight with fists; she fights with her art. This placement is classic for artists who channel their anger or frustration into music. It also suggests that she needs plenty of alone time to access her motivation. If she pushes herself too hard in the material world, she risks burnout; her power comes from the dream world.

Venus in Sagittarius: Freedom in Love and Style

Venus, the planet of love, beauty, and money, is in Sagittarius. This reinforces her Sun sign's desire for freedom. In relationships, Billie needs a partner who is also her best friend—someone who won't clip her wings. She values honesty over romance and adventure over stability.

Aesthetically, Venus in Sagittarius rejects the "pretty" or "polished" look. It favors bold, comfortable, and statement-making styles. Her iconic baggy clothes era is a perfect expression of this—rejecting the sexualization of the female body (a very Sagittarius rebellious move) in favor of comfort and mystery.

Mercury in Capricorn: The Mature Voice

One of the most striking things about Billie is her songwriting. It is mature beyond her years. This is the gift of Mercury in Capricorn.

Mercury rules communication, and Capricorn is the sign of the elder, the authority, and the structure. Even at 15, she wrote lyrics that sounded like they came from an old soul. This placement grounds her watery Pisces and fiery Sagittarius energy, giving her the discipline to work hard in the studio and the business savvy to navigate the music industry. She doesn't just sing; she crafts.

Stelliums and Dominant Elements

Billie’s chart features a powerful concentration of energy in the 10th House (Career/Public Status) and the 11th House (Community/Hopes).

  • The 10th House Stellium: With her Sun, Mercury, and Venus all hovering near the top of her chart (the Midheaven), she was cosmically "doomed" to be famous. The 10th House is the most visible part of the chart. When multiple planets sit here, the person is thrust into the spotlight, often at a young age.
  • Mutable Dominance: With strong placements in Sagittarius (Sun, Venus) and Pisces (Mars, Rising), Billie is a "Mutable" dominant person. This means she is adaptable, flexible, and constantly changing. She will never make the same album twice. She flows with the times, evolving her sound and image before the public gets bored.

Major Aspects That Create Genius

It is the tension in a chart that creates the diamond. Billie has a few key "aspects" (conversations between planets) that drive her success.

Sun Conjunct Venus (Sagittarius): This aspect creates a natural magnetism. People are simply drawn to her light. It blends her identity (Sun) with her artistic values (Venus), ensuring that her career is a true reflection of what she loves.

Mars Square Pluto: This is a heavy, intense aspect. Mars (action) clashing with Pluto (power/transformation) creates a tremendous amount of internal pressure. It gives her an "edge." It can manifest as fears, nightmares, or a fascination with the darker side of life—themes heavily explored in her debut album, When We All Fall Asleep, Where Do We Go?. This aspect is the engine of her intensity; without it, her music might be too soft.

Mercury Sextile Mars: This helpful angle links her mind (Mercury) with her drive (Mars). It allows her to put her thoughts into action quickly. When she has an idea for a song, she has the energy to execute it immediately.

How Billie Eilish's Birth Chart Affects Her Career

Billie Eilish's career path is a textbook example of a 10th House Sun supported by a creative 12th House.

The 12th House is the realm of the collective unconscious—dreams, fears, and the things we don't talk about. By tapping into this house (via her Mars and Rising ruler), she retrieves deep, often dark emotions that most people are afraid to feel. She then uses her 10th House (Sun/Mercury) to broadcast these feelings to the world.

She acts as a mirror for society. When she sings about depression or fear, she isn't just singing about herself; she is channeling the collective mood. This is the hallmark of a generational icon.

Astrological Timing: Key Turning Points

We can see astrology at work in the timing of her success.

2015-2016 (Ocean Eyes): As "Ocean Eyes" went viral, Neptune (the planet of illusion and dreams—and her chart ruler) was transiting her Ascendant. This is a "once in a lifetime" transit that glamorizes a person, making them appear almost magical to the public. It was the perfect cosmic weather for a Pisces Rising to be discovered.

Billie Eilish holding her 2020 Grammy Awards

2019-2020 (Grammy Sweep): During her massive sweep of the Grammys, Jupiter (planet of luck and expansion) was moving through her 10th House of Career, crossing over her Natal Sun. This is the classic "peak year" transit, bringing massive recognition and rewards.
